DPR & CMA Data on Bentonite powder

Project Overview

Bentonite powder is a versatile and widely used material derived from volcanic ash that has undergone chemical weathering. It consists primarily of montmorillonite clay and has significant industrial applications due to its unique properties such as swelling, plasticity, and viscosity. Bentonite is utilized in a variety of industries, including drilling, construction, absorbents, and as a binding agent in various processes. The drilling industry extensively employs bentonite for its ability to form a mud slurry, which aids in lubricating drill bits and stabilizing boreholes. Additionally, in the construction sector, bentonite acts as a waterproofing agent in foundations and basements because of its remarkable capacity to swell upon water contact, creating a sealing effect. The pharmaceutical and cosmetics industries use bentonite for its absorbent qualities, ensuring purity and effectiveness in products. Furthermore, environmental applications, such as wastewater treatment and containment of hazardous materials, leverage the exceptional adsorption properties of bentonite. Overall, the combination of economical costs, versatility, and wide-ranging applicability contributes to the sustained demand for bentonite powder across numerous sectors, positioning it as a vital component in both established and emerging markets.
